Dyadic Expands Non-Animal Dairy Pipeline via European License Agreement

Dyadic Applied BioSolutions announced a development and commercial license with a European partner to expand its non-animal dairy protein portfolio. The deal broadens the Dapibus platform's reach and complements existing chymosin and alpha-lactalbumin programs, potentially generating development payments, licensing revenues, and future product sales as programs scale.

  • Dyadic expands non-animal dairy pipeline with European license agreement.
  • Agreement unlocks development and commercial payments; licensing revenues may follow.
  • Dapibus platform enables rapid, scalable dairy protein development and production.
  • Program advances strain optimization and commercial-scale activities.
